
Job Overview
Location
Poland
Job Type
Full-time
Category
Embedded Engineer
Date Posted
March 18, 2026
Full Job Description
đź“‹ Description
- • This role is a Senior Embedded Video Streaming Engineer position focused on developing real-time, low-latency video streaming solutions for smart home and IoT devices. The engineer will work within a dedicated streaming team of 20 experts, contributing to both cloud and embedded streaming domains for camera-based security products, where technical excellence directly impacts product reliability and user experience in a global market.
- • Day-to-day responsibilities include developing and optimizing embedded video streaming software, writing and integrating C/C++ components for real-time pipelines, troubleshooting networking and streaming issues in embedded Linux environments, conducting end-to-end device testing, analyzing streaming KPIs such as latency and jitter, participating in code reviews, contributing to technical documentation, and adhering to team engineering standards to ensure high-quality, maintainable code.
- • The team operates within a global smart home security company with a specialized streaming department, emphasizing deep technical expertise in real-time media pipelines. Engineers collaborate closely across embedded and cloud domains, fostering innovation in low-resource, high-performance video delivery systems used in consumer IoT devices deployed worldwide.
- • In this role, the engineer will deepen expertise in real-time streaming protocols, embedded multimedia frameworks, and network optimization under constraints. They will gain hands-on influence over architectural decisions, improve system reliability through root-cause analysis, and develop leadership potential by mentoring peers and driving technical excellence in a high-impact streaming team.
🎯 Requirements
- • 5+ years of commercial experience in embedded development
- • 2–3+ years of direct hands-on experience with video/audio streaming
- • Strong C and C++ development skills; C++ is the primary language, with C also used in the project
- • Commercial experience with Embedded Linux - mandatory
- • Hands-on experience with streaming frameworks such as GStreamer, FFmpeg, WebRTC, or similar - mandatory
- • Proven experience with real-time, low-latency video streaming on resource-constrained devices
- • Strong networking background, including TCP/IP, UDP/TCP, VoIP, and Video over IP
- • Experience troubleshooting streaming and networking issues in embedded environments
- • Strong problem-solving skills and ability to identify root causes
- • Good written and spoken English
🏖️ Benefits
- • Competitive compensation and benefits package
- • Private medical insurance
- • Paid vacation and statutory leave
- • Annual performance and loyalty bonus opportunities
- • Internal learning resources, courses, and English classes
- • Fully remote work within Poland (Wrocław office optional)
Skills & Technologies
About Onhires Inc.
Onhires is a talent acquisition platform designed to streamline the hiring process for businesses. It offers a comprehensive suite of tools that automate and optimize various stages of recruitment, from sourcing candidates to onboarding new hires. The platform aims to reduce time-to-hire and improve the quality of hires by leveraging intelligent automation and data-driven insights. Key features include applicant tracking, candidate sourcing, interview scheduling, and performance analytics, all integrated into a user-friendly interface. Onhires serves companies seeking to enhance their recruitment efficiency and build stronger teams by making the hiring journey more effective and less resource-intensive.
Similar Opportunities
1 month ago


